How to Choose the Right Somerset English Class

This is where things get practical. You’ve found a list of options, but how do you pick one that actually works for you?

Start with your schedule. If you work late hours, look for classes that offer evening slots or weekend sessions. Many Somerset English Classes SG providers understand that adults have jobs, so they structure their timings accordingly. Some even offer weekday morning classes for those who work shift hours or have flexible arrangements.

Then consider your current level. Are you a complete beginner, or do you just need to polish your spoken English? Some schools offer placement tests to help you figure this out. It’s worth taking these tests seriously because being placed in the wrong level wastes both time and money.

Think about class size. Smaller groups usually mean more speaking time. If you’re shy about speaking in front of others, you might prefer one-on-one lessons. On the other hand, group classes give you exposure to different accents and speaking styles, which is valuable in a multicultural city like Singapore.

Check the qualifications of the teachers. It’s surprising how many people forget to do this. Good teachers should have relevant qualifications like CELTA or DELTA, and ideally some experience teaching adults in a professional context.

Finally, look at the curriculum. Does the course cover the specific skills you need? For example, if you’re preparing for presentations, look for classes that include public speaking practice. If you need help with writing, find a course that emphasises written communication.

Are there evening English classes near Somerset?

Yes, many language schools near Somerset offer evening classes that start around 7:00 PM or 7:30 PM. These are specifically designed for working adults who finish their day around 6:00 PM. Some schools also offer Saturday morning sessions.

How much do English classes in Somerset cost?

Prices vary depending on the school and the type of course. Group classes typically range from SGD 400 to SGD 800 per term, while private lessons can cost between SGD 80 and SGD 150 per hour. It’s best to contact the schools directly for accurate pricing.

Can I take a trial class before committing?

Most schools in the Somerset area offer trial lessons or placement tests. These usually cost a small fee or are sometimes free. It’s a good way to assess the teaching style and class environment before you pay for a full course.
